Figure CEO Says Humanoid Robots Could Soon Enter Homes For $600 A Month
Figure CEO Says Humanoid Robots Could Soon Enter Homes For $600 A Month
Figure's CEO told Sourcery's Molly O'Shea that the humanoid robotics company is preparing for a "near-term" push to bring humanoid robots into homes, where they would perform basic household tasks under a consumer subscription model that could cost "hundreds per month," similar to a car lease.
